Title:                      “Lituania Dedicata All’Illustrissimo Signore Gio: Pietro Caualli Segretario della Serenisima Republica di Venetia…”​

Description:
Very rare and a detailed map of the Grand Duchy of Lithuania, extending into parts of present-day Poland, Latvia and Belarus. It shows the main river systems, a dense network of towns and roads, and the bordering regions of Samogitia, Courland, Livonia, Prussia, Podlasie and Volhynia.

Large title cartouche with a formal dedication to Venetian secretary Gio Pietro Cavalli, he was one of the atlas’ sponsor. A second ornamental cartouche (scale/notes) and numerous coats of arms scattered across the map—including the Lithuanian Vytis—typical of Coronelli’s bold, baroque style.

The map comes from Coronelli’s atlas “Corso geografico universale, o sia, La terra divisa nelle sue parti, e subdistinta ne’ suoi gran regni / esposta in tavole geografiche, ricorrette, et accresciute di tutte le nuove scoperte, ad uso dell’Accademia cosmografica degli Argonauti dal padre maestro Vincenzo Coronelli M.C…” published in Venice, 1690.

Cartographer:                Vincenzo Maria Coronelli (1650-1718)
Engraving size:              68,0 x 49,2 cm
Year:                                   1690
Technique:                       copper engraving
